Mail room move — note for team assistants. From Monday, all post handling shifts from Floor 1 to the new mail suite beside goods-in at Quarrow House. Courier collections, franking, and the oversized-parcel shelf all move with it. Update any saved delivery instructions for your teams. The suite door stays locked during sorting hours, so entry requires the pass below.

turnstile pass: bdg-JVSWH-52711

## Changed defaults

Quick one for support: the Kioskly watchdog now restarts a frozen unit after 45 seconds instead of three minutes, so customers at the Pinefield stores should see far fewer "stuck screen" calls. Reboots are logged locally as before. The watchdog reads these defaults at startup.

deployment values, tajef-tajep:
QUENOX_LOG_LEVEL=debug
QUENOX_METRICS_HOST=metrics.quenox.zemvarsys.corp
QUENOX_POOL_SIZE=4

Escalation — Spanview diff viewer (large files). Symptoms: viewer times out or renders blank on files over 50 MB. First steps: confirm the file size, check the render-worker queue depth, restart the spanview-render pod if queue exceeds 500. Do not raise worker memory limits without approval. If restart does not clear the backlog within 15 minutes, page the on-call via the standard rotation and note the incident channel in your ticket. For non-urgent issues or questions about supported file sizes, email the owning team at the address below.

escalation mailbox, bafog-fafog: ulador@paliqlabs.internal

## Data Stores — Billing Worker (Quillpay)

Blue-green deploys: both colors share one billing database. Never run migrations from the green side. Cutover flips the Harrier router; drain takes ~90s. Verify ledger writes stopped on blue before teardown. Read-only checks against the shared store use the string below.

primary connection of yagep-kahip = redis://giliel_svc:zYiKsLL2PLpfPL@db-348f.xolmarsys.corp:5432/fenwyn